    If you put your unit in stand by mode before starting your motor it will not turn off. Otherwise for me it is hit or miss. I have 2 units at the console. If I forget to put them in stand by (sleep mode) before starting the motor then 1 or both units may cut off. Only takes a couple of seconds to do and better than restarting my units which are networked together.

    Most likely you have an issue with the power wiring. Set one of the readouts to display the voltage on the unit .... look for low voltage or fluctuating voltage. With good wiring and good battery you should never see below 12V. If your wiring is really good, you will never see below 12.4V

    I had a pair of HB 998s networked together with ethernet. The bow unit was wired to the power block under the bow panel and the console unit to power block under the console using factory wiring and 27 series battery. Worked great for many yrs.

    Replaced bow unit with Helix 10 Mega Chirp DI G2N and immediately started to have issues (low voltage warnings, unit recycling, etc). Bought another Helix 10 Mega Chirp SI to replace the 998 at the console BUT ran new 12 gauge wiring from unit to battery with in-line fuse for both units and replaced the battery with 31 AGM. No power issues of any kind since then and it's been almost a year now. Guess the Helix units require more, cleaner power and are more sensitive to borderline power issues.
